Leadership Review Briefing – Cardelo Coffee Group

Quick brief ahead of Thursday: the proposed franchise agreement with Tovane Holdings covers twelve outlets across the Eastmoor region, five-year term, standard royalty structure. Legal has flagged the exclusivity clause; Ms. Ibarra wants board input before we counter. Overall, the economics look solid. The confidential strategy note sits just below.

management briefing: The renewal with Oliixek Group closes at $10 million a year, 5 percent below the last contract. Project Holix slips by one quarter because of the tooling delay.

Subject: Key rotation — Feedproof validator

Team: the Feedproof podcast feed validator key rotates tonight at 02:00. Old key stops working at 03:00. Update any local scripts that hit the validation endpoint before then. CI configs are already patched; only ad-hoc tooling is affected. No downtime expected. Flag issues in the sync thread tomorrow. The new validator key follows.

gateway credential: kto23_dolYgAScEh2TaPOlStqOl98

## Formula sandbox tuning

User-supplied formulas in Gridmoor execute inside a restricted interpreter with hard ceilings on time, memory, and call depth. Reviewers should confirm any change to these ceilings is justified in the PR description, since raising them widens the abuse surface. Defaults were chosen from production traces. The current limits are as follows.

limits module of tafog-fawip:
WEIGHTS = {
    "julix": 57,
    "lamys": 992,
    "kasvan": 209,
    "quenok": 750,
    "alddor": 259,
    "oliath": 1009,
    "wenix": 815,
}

## Support

Quillforge template rendering should stay under 50ms per page. If it doesn't: check the partial cache hit rate first, then the loop-depth warnings in the render log. Most regressions come from unbounded includes. Don't tune the compiler flags yourself — file a ticket. Full profiling guide lives in the Renderlab wiki. For urgent performance incidents, or if the dashboard itself is down, reach the Quillforge core team at the address below.

pager mailbox: silael.sorwyn.tamius@zemvarsys.corp